Wizz-Air First Passengers Landed at Tuzla Airport

Published May 30, 2013
Share
SHARE

tuzla aerodromThe first 149 passengers from Malmo in Sweden landed yesterday in Tuzla airport, which marked the start of the regular lines from and to the international airport in Tuzla. On 15 June, there will be regular flights to Basel and to Gothenburg from 17 June.

“During the last several months, Wizz Air has been actively investing in the development of the aviation and tourism industry in BIH. Today we have reached an important milestone. We have waited a long time for a connection with Malmo, and with the three flights a week for Malmo we are announcing the introduction of low prices in BiH. Our presence in Tuzla once again demonstrates our commitment ot BiH and we hop for the further development of our business in this market’’, said the Commercial Director of Wizz Air Gyorgy Abran last night.

Wizz Air Company is the biggest low-cost airlines in Central and Eastern Europe.

Wizz Air’s team of 1.600 professionals lends superior services and very low prices, and makes this company a more acceptable choice for more than 13,5 passengers in 2013.
